Identification and Creation Object Number 2024.38 People Johann Ladenspelder, German (c. 1521 - 1561) After Albrecht Dürer, German (Nuremberg 1471 - 1528 Nuremberg) Title The Sudarium Displayed by Two Angels Classification Prints Work Type print Date c. 1550 Culture German Persistent Link https://hvrd.art/o/382912 Physical Descriptions Medium Engraving on off-white antique laid paper Technique Engraving Dimensions 10 × 13.7 cm (3 15/16 × 5 3/8 in.) Inscriptions and Marks inscription: bottom left, in plate: IHVE inscription: center, in plate: 1513 / AD [in monogram] inscription: verso, lower right, erased graphite: [illegible text] Provenance Recorded Ownership History Robert Flynn Johnson. Stuart and Beverly Denenberg, gift; to Harvard Art Museums, 2024 State, Edition, Standard Reference Number Standard Reference Number Bartsch 25 Acquisition and Rights Credit Line Harvard Art Museums/Fogg Museum, Gift of Stuart and Beverly Denenberg in honor of Marjorie Cohn’s magisterial biography of Joseph Pulitzer Accession Year 2024 Object Number 2024.38 Division European and American Art Contact am_europeanamerican@harvard.edu Permissions The Harvard Art Museums encourage the use of images found on this website for personal, noncommercial use, including educational and scholarly purposes.
